undefined being treated as a missing optional argument

Sam Tobin-Hochstadt samth at ccs.neu.edu
Fri Apr 13 15:42:54 PDT 2012

On Fri, Apr 13, 2012 at 5:42 PM, Brendan Eich <brendan at mozilla.org> wrote:
> Sam has similar testimony from Racket (neé PLT-Scheme).

Very much so -- I've encountered places where Racket's semantics for
keyword arguments (which is similar to what Allen proposes for ES6)
ends up causing the entire set of keyword arguments to be propagated
back up the chain and provided in full at every call site.
sam th
samth at ccs.neu.edu

